Wire Mesh Applications: From Construction to Art

Wire mesh presents a surprisingly broad range of applications, extending far beyond its traditional role in construction and infrastructure. While it remains a crucial component for reinforcing concrete structures, fencing, and sieving materials, wire mesh has also emerged as an surprising material in the realm of art and design. Artists employ the inherent texture and sturdiness of wire mesh to create complex sculptures,wall installations, and even wearable pieces. The malleability 6@20 of wire mesh allows for fluid shapes, while its open structure creates a sense of lightness. From utilitarian applications to artistic expressions, wire mesh continues to transform as a functional material that bridges the gap between practicality and creativity.

The Ultimate Solution for Your Projects

Wire mesh is a incredibly versatile material with a wide range of purposes. Its strength and malleability make it an ideal choice for countless industries. From agriculture, to screening, wire mesh plays a vital role in our daily lives. Whether you need a durable barrier or a precise sieve, there is a variety of wire mesh to meet your specific needs.

  • Various common uses for wire mesh include:
  • Construction: Reinforcing concrete, creating security barriers
  • Production: Conveying materials, protecting equipment
  • Farming: Protecting crops from pests, making animal cages
  • Separation: Removing impurities from liquids or gases
